WebMay 2, 2016 · Filling Holes Removal of existing hardware sometimes leaves holes in the surface of the door or frame. NFPA 80 requires holes to be repaired either by installing steel fasteners that completely fill the holes, or filling the screw or bolt holes with the same material as the door or frame. WebJan 3, 2024 · Install metal flashing (drip cap) over the entire length of the top of the ledger. Custom cut and fit another strip of flashing over this drip cap and under doors to cover and protect remaining unflashed areas under doorsills. Caulk the gap between the flashing and the bottom of door thresholds.
